Williams F1 Team Boss Releases Statement After Long Term Contract Extension

Williams team principal James Vowles has announced a long-term contract extension after joining the team in 2023. Vowles will continue leading the Grove-based outfit in its quest to become a championship-winning team.

In a statement posted on X, Vowles acknowledged that though the goal remains distant, he is confident that Williams is heading in the right direction. Having arrived from Mercedes in 2023, a team that had won nine Constructors’ Championships, Vowles is aware of the mindset a winning team needs to have.

One major step to getting closer to his goal was signing former Ferrari driver Carlos Sainz last year, after the Maranello outfit signed Lewis Hamilton for the 2025 campaign. Convincing Sainz to take the wheel of a car that constantly finished outside the points was a big ask. However, it was Vowles’ leadership and his vision for the team’s future that motivated him to take the leap of faith.

Announcing his contract extension on X, Vowles wrote:

“I am absolutely delighted to have signed a new long-term contract with Atlassian Williams Racing. Remaining at Williams was never in doubt, but I’m really pleased to have formalised it.

“This team has felt like home from the moment I walked through the door. It really is a special place and we have an amazing opportunity to get it back where it belongs: building on Sir Frank’s legacy and winning World Championships.

“We aren’t there yet but we are on the right path. We have done some good work fixing the foundations. To be clear, it isn’t my work – it is your work. The great privilege of this job is in getting 1,000 people pointing in the right direction to deliver results. We now have the platform to build from. We have the investment we need from Dorilton, a world-class driver line-up in Alex and Carlos, top global brands as partners, and a growing global fanbase.

“I’m excited as to what we can achieve together in the years ahead.”

The chairman of Atlassian Williams Racing and Dorilton Capital, Matthew Savage, said in a statement:

“We are thrilled that James has signed a new contract with Atlassian Williams Racing and committed his future to completing the mission that we are on together. He has brought experience, energy and strategic leadership to the task of restoring Williams to the top step of the podium. We aren’t there yet but you can sense the momentum we are building at Grove and are excited about what lies ahead.”
